To preface I'm not as intimately familiar with Korean myth culture as an actual Korean citizen so there are probably some inaccuracies especially bc I’m just doing a quick breakdown.
Korean myths stem from indigenous beliefs, Confucianism and Bhuddism so they don't have heaven, hell and angels as you'd see them in Abrahamic religions. This also makes it kind of complex to explain lol. The most important thing though is that their underworld is very bureaucratic and that souls are very important.
It’s said that the soul(hon) lingers for four generations, and the soul is guided to the underworld to pass through the 10 Kings and be judged by King Yeomna(Yama) the ruler of the underworld in order to enter the reincarnation cycle.
That’s what makes Gwi-Ma such a problem in the film, he’s unnatural. He actively orders the deaths of humans bypassing the established 'rules' the underworld follows and he eats souls that are meant to move on. It's also important note that he consumes the souls immediately bc it's believed that the soul is vulnerable within the first 50 days of death.
Even more unnatural is how he collects them, we see Jinu and other spirits in black gat and hanbok leading and enabling lesser demons to collect the souls. They’re Jeoseung Saja (저승사자-grim reapers) but wrong. Jeoseung Saja are neutral forces. They're workers for King Yama and they’re sometimes portrayed as sinners who are guiding souls in atonement for their sins in life.
Then there’s whatever is going on with the patterns he uses to control the demons. His minions, save the saja boys, are akgwi (악귀 -evil spirits) so it’s very strange how he managed to get what are essentially spirit cops to do his bidding.
Where your reader could come in is where the hunters get involved. The first hunters we see were actually mudang(무당), a female shaman(무-mu). That's why song and dance are so integral to the plot bc alot of rituals mudang preform involve song and dance. Mudang act as the go between for spirits and humans and do all sorts of rituals from communication with lingering spirits to healing. They're also said to be possessed by either ancestral spirits or deities which is what allows them to communicate with the supernatural.
